      1. Obituary for father of James Sagalyn that mentions Jane Herzenberg. Published in the Hartford Courant on 7/1/2004: "SAGALYN, Irwin Irwin Sagalyn, a lifelong resident of the Pioneer Valley who had been Chairman and President of Holyoke Machine Company, a manufacturer of paper mill machinery since 1948, died Wednesday, (June 23, 2004) at Baystate Medical Center after a brief illness. He was 88. Born in Springfield, MA to Dora Katz and Raphael Sagalyn, who founded Industrial Buildings Corporation (now Cabotville Industrial Park) in Chicopee in the 1930's. Raphael Sagalyn also was the founder of the Jewish Community Center in Springfield. Irwin Sagalyn was a professional engineer who attended Technical High School and graduated from M.I.T. in 1937. He continued to work until three months prior to his death. He married Lucy Rothenberg in 1943 and they lived in Northampton at the time of his death. A lifelong learner, Sagalyn recently took computer and Spanish classes at Holyoke Community College. A relentless tinkerer in 1954 he solved his strong aversion to advertisements on television by wiring a simple device to control the audio component of the TV, thus devising an early version of the remote control. He devoted himself to several local and political causes, including public television and radio stations, the ACLU, and scores of Democratic Party Candidates from Adlai Stevenson to John Dean and John Kerry. Sagalyn is survived by his wife of 61 years, Lucy Rothenberg Sagalyn; and three children, James Sagalyn of Northampton, MA who succeed him as President of Holyoke Machine Company and his wife, Jane Herzenberg, Ann Sagalyn Marks of West Hartford, a dentist, and her husband, David Marks, Raphael Sagalyn of Bethesda, MD, a literary agent, and his wife, Dr. Anne Boas Sagalyn. He leaves three grandchildren, Emily, Rebecca, and Erica Sagalyn; and two step grandchildren, Jesse and Sheena Reiter.
